cunning

adj.
1.attractive especially by means of smallness or prettiness or quaintness
2.marked by skill in deception
3.showing inventiveness and skill cunning n.
1.shrewdness in deception
2.shrewdness as demonstrated by being skilled in deception
3.drafty artfulness (especially in deception)
